Runtime.getRuntime().exec("cmd /c start d://a.xls")
getRuntime()是取得系统运行时环境
start参数表名直接启动excel文件,相当于双击操作 ,是个windows命令.
---------------------------------------------------------------
package com.yly.java;
import java.util.*;
import java.io.*;
class AppRun
{
public static void main(String[] args){
String filePath = "E:\\TestExcel.xls";
try{
Runtime.getRuntime().exec("cmd /c start " + filePath);
}catch(IOException e){
System.out.println("打开文件出错");
}
}
}
分享到:
相关推荐
本资源“Java使用默认浏览器打开指定URL的方法(二种方法).rar”提供了两种实现这一目标的方法。下面将详细阐述这两种方法。 **方法一:使用Desktop类** Java从1.6版本开始引入了`java.awt.Desktop`类,它提供了...
在Windows操作系统上,安装JDK通常使用的是自解压可执行文件(.exe),而卸载时系统通常需要原始的.msi安装文件来执行完整的卸载过程。 `.msi`文件是Microsoft Installer的安装包格式,它是Windows平台下用于安装、...
这段代码会尝试使用用户的默认程序(通常是Windows的帮助查看器)打开指定的.chm文件。如果文件不存在或不是有效的.chm文件,程序会给出相应的提示。 值得注意的是,调用外部程序时,你需要考虑跨平台兼容性。`...
在Java编程环境中,有时我们需要将开发的程序提供给非Java开发者或用户,这时将Java应用程序转换为可执行的Windows .exe文件就显得很有必要。这个过程通常被称为“封装”或“部署”,它允许用户在没有Java环境的情况...
Java程序通常运行在Java虚拟机(JVM)上,但有时我们需要将其转换为可以在没有Java环境的计算机上执行的可执行文件(exe),这通常是为了方便非开发人员使用或者简化部署流程。`exe4j` 和 `Inno Setup` 是两个用于此...
在Windows环境下配置JAVA环境变量是运行Java应用程序的基础步骤之一,对于初学者来说,理解并正确设置这些环境变量至关重要。本文将详细解析如何在Windows系统中设置JAVA_HOME、CLASSPATH和PATH这三个关键的环境变量...
在安装过程中,系统会自动将JDK安装到指定目录,并且一般会默认设置JAVA_HOME环境变量,指向JDK的安装路径,同时将bin目录添加到PATH环境变量中,以便在任何地方都能运行Java命令。 JDK 1.8引入了许多重要的特性,...
- 编辑`/etc/jvm`文件,指定默认的JVM路径: ```sh /usr/lib/jvm/java-6-sun ``` - 这一步是为了确保系统使用正确的JVM版本。 4. **验证安装**: - 在终端中输入`java -version`和`javac -version`命令,检查...
这个任务可以通过使用Java的`java.awt.Desktop`类来完成,该类提供了一种与操作系统进行交互的方法,包括打开浏览器、编辑文件、播放音频等。在"java 打开浏览器"这个主题中,我们将深入探讨如何使用Java实现这一...
Java程序通常运行在Java虚拟机(JVM)上,但为了在没有安装Java环境的Windows系统上方便地执行,开发者可能会需要将Java程序打包成.exe可执行文件。这里我们将详细讲解如何使用JBuider2005将Java项目打包成.exe。 ...
批处理文件(batch file)是Windows操作系统中的一种脚本文件,它能自动化执行一系列命令,大大简化了包括Java环境变量设置在内的系统管理任务。下面我们将详细探讨如何利用批处理文件来设置Java环境变量。 首先,...
通过以上步骤,你可以将Java生成的JAR文件转化为可以在任何未配置JRE的Windows操作系统上运行的.EXE文件,并进一步制作成安装包。这种方法不仅简化了用户的操作流程,还提高了软件的易用性和兼容性。
本文档介绍了一个使用Java Server Pages (JSP)技术实现的文件管理系统。该系统旨在模拟Windows资源管理器的功能,允许用户通过Web界面来访问、浏览及管理服务器上的文件与目录。通过此系统,用户可以执行诸如查看...
根据给定的信息,我们可以推断出这段代码的主要目的是在Java程序中执行一个操作来打开Windows系统的C盘。接下来,我们将详细解析这段代码的功能,并探讨如何使用Java语言与操作系统进行交互。 ### Java程序调用操作...
Java程序中指定某个浏览器打开的实现方法 在 Java 程序中打开指定的浏览器是一种常见的需求,例如在某些应用场景中需要打开特定的浏览器来访问某个网站。下面将介绍四种不同的方法来实现 Java 程序中指定某个浏览器...
在Java编程中,有时我们需要实现一个功能,即通过程序控制打开本地已安装的浏览器并访问特定的URL地址。这在很多场景下都很有用,比如自动化测试、应用内部的链接跳转或者用户指南等。本篇将详细介绍如何使用Java来...
本文将详细介绍如何使用Java来调用Windows命令行,包括执行DOS内部命令、打开不可执行文件以及处理具有标准输出的DOS可执行程序等常见场景。 #### 1. 使用`Runtime`类和`Process`类调用命令 Java提供了`java.lang....
这个过程主要包括两个主要步骤:首先,将Java应用程序打包成JAR文件,然后使用特定工具将其转换为Windows下的EXE可执行文件,并创建一个安装包。 1. **打包成JAR文件**: 在Java开发环境中,如MyEclipse,你可以将...
5. 运行工程,使用`java`命令指定包含主方法的类名,格式为`java [工程目录名]/[主类文件名]`。在这种情况下,输入`java helloworld/start`。 在DOS命令行下编译Java文件或工程时,还需要注意以下几点: - 如果...
批处理文件通常使用Windows的命令行工具,如`dir`命令来列出指定目录下的文件。例如,一个基本的批处理文件(locationClass.bat)可能包含以下内容: ```bat @echo off cd /d %~dp0 dir /b bin\*.class ``` 这个...